    5.0
    Corporate sales executive
    Jul 2015
    3 to 4 years in the role, current employee
    Sales
    The good things- Very friendly colleagues & environment - Able to have close relationship with managers / Managing Director due to small number of employees in office - Managers and MD took care of staffs. - High chances to get promoted - Company dinners and company trips for all members (including newly hired) - Able to travel overseas for training and other sales office visit
    The challenges- Systems are complicated to learn up but as time passes, frequent usage of the system will - Sales position too has a lot of paper works to be done and meetings to attend. - Language barrier with Japanese managers which caused communication failure. - Trainings are provided by seniors only on basic knowledge. There's still many things that has to learn by own self. - Has to be independent
